The work of acclaimed German artist Christoph Schlingensief spans three decades and a diverse range of fields, including, film, television, activism, opera, and theatre. Christoph Schlingensief: Art Without Borders is the first book to be published in English on Schlingensief's groundbreaking, politically engaged body of work. Leading scholars in the field offer a critical assessment of Schlingensief's hybrid practice, and an interview with Schlingensief himself provides the reader with insight into past and present projects. The book will be an essential resource for artists, curators, students, and academics in the fields of theater and performance studies, film studies, cultural studies, German studies, political activism, and art history.

Z : 21 × 29,7 cm, 8 ¼ × 11 ¾ in, 232 pages, 217 illustrations - David Benjamin is the founding principal of The Living and an assistant professor of Columbia GSAPP. His work combines research and practice, exploring new ideas through prototyping. Focusing on the intersection of biology, computation, and design, Benjamin has articulated bio-computing, bio-sensing, and bio-manufacturing as frameworks for harnessing living organisms in architecture.
